nThrive, an Alpharetta, Georgia-based patient-to-payment solutions company, has signed an agreement to acquire Adreima, a Downers Grove, Illinois provider of clinically-integrated revenue cycle services. The acquisition adds patient eligibility determination, enrollment services and strengthened patient advocacy and self-pay collections capabilities to nThrive's revenue cycle offerings and is expected to close prior to year-end 2016.

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. (Gallagher) acquired KRW Insurance Agency, Inc., a Crystal Lake, Illinois-based retail insurance broker. KRW, established in the 1940s, provides commercial property/casualty, risk management, employee benefits and personal lines with specializations in the construction and manufacturing industries; management will continue to operate under Gallagher's Midwest region.

Crestview Capital Partners has acquired KP Counseling, a state-licensed outpatient mental health and addiction treatment provider based in Rockford, Illinois. Founder Kevin Polky remains as a partner and clinical manager; Crestview says the purchase will help expand its behavioral-healthcare platform and geographic reach across the Midwest.

SmithBucklin has acquired SDI, a Chicago-based incentive travel, strategic meetings and special events firm. SDI will operate as a wholly owned subsidiary out of SmithBucklin’s Chicago office with SDI founder Scott Dillion remaining as President, enhancing SmithBucklin’s corporate event-planning capabilities and incentive travel expertise.
